About Daniela Schlütz
Daniela Schlütz is a scholar working on Communication, Literature and Literary Theory and Marketing, having authored 34 papers that have together received 289 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Media Influence and Health (9 papers), Media Studies and Communication (9 papers) and Sociology and Education Studies (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Communication (119 citations), Literature and Literary Theory (55 citations) and Applied Psychology (22 citations). Daniela Schlütz has collaborated with scholars based in Germany, Austria and Czechia. Frequent co-authors include Wiebke Möhring, Veronika Karnowski, Teresa K. Naab, Helmut Scherer, Christopher Buschow, Paul Clemens Murschetz, Elena Link, Christopher Blake, Katja Kaufmann and Anna Schnauber-Stockmann.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Communication Research and Annals of the International Communication Association.
